Planning for Electrical Needs

Before any demolition begins, it’s crucial to have a comprehensive plan for your kitchen’s electrical system. This plan should include:

  • Appliance Needs: Make a list of all appliances you plan to have in your kitchen, including their wattage and voltage requirements.
  • Lighting Design: Determine the placement of ceiling lights, under-cabinet lighting, pendant lights, and any other desired lighting features, specifying the type of bulbs and fixtures.
  • Outlet Placement: Carefully consider the location and number of outlets needed, keeping in mind countertop appliances, islands, peninsulas, and charging stations.
  • Dedicated Circuits: High-power appliances, such as ovens, ranges, and microwaves, require dedicated circuits to prevent overloading and ensure safe operation.

Installing GFCI Outlets

Ground Fault Circuit Interrupters (GFCI) are essential safety devices, especially in kitchens where water and electricity are often in close proximity. GFCI outlets quickly shut off power if they detect a ground fault, preventing potentially fatal electrical shocks. Building codes require GFCI outlets near sinks, dishwashers, and other areas where water is present.

Dedicated Circuits and Appliance Power Demands

High-power appliances like ovens, ranges, microwaves, and dishwashers require dedicated circuits to handle their electrical loads without overloading the system. Licensed electricians will calculate the appropriate amperage for each appliance and ensure the wiring and circuit breakers are properly sized to prevent potential hazards.
